Output 68c104b79667a17fd512c7f24280efe415d6f45aab079df4955c1d7f5488261a:1

value
47527094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 971cac6be81d0ceb58077e1ffe0db764f13bb91c OP_EQUAL
address
MMgAcfggJ7Sj46FxZQ92EY9up8q1FNqLyN
transaction
68c104b79667a17fd512c7f24280efe415d6f45aab079df4955c1d7f5488261a
spent
true